Firstly, one of the most critical factors determining when you can visit a casino is the legal age requirement. In many jurisdictions, the legal age to gamble is either 18 or 21 years old. This age limit varies by location, so it is crucial to check the specific laws in your area or the region where the casino is located. For example, in Las Vegas, Nevada, individuals must be at least 21 years old to enter casinos, while in some states, such as New Jersey, 18-year-olds can enter certain establishments. Always carry a valid form of identification to verify your age when visiting a casino.
Operational hours also play a significant role in determining when you can visit a casino. Most casinos operate 24 hours a day, seven days a week, allowing for flexibility in planning your visit. However, some casinos may have specific hours for certain areas, such as restaurants, bars, or entertainment venues. It is advisable to check the casino’s website or contact them directly to confirm their hours of operation before planning your trip. Additionally, during holidays or special events, casinos may extend their hours or implement temporary changes to their schedules.
Another important consideration is the availability of special events or promotions. Many casinos host various events, including tournaments, live entertainment, and themed nights that may influence your decision on when to visit. These events can attract larger crowds, so if you prefer a quieter experience, consider visiting during off-peak times, typically on weekdays or during non-holiday periods. Conversely, if you are looking for a lively atmosphere, attending during a special event or weekend may be more appealing.
